Image MaskingMasking is the process of hiding some portion of photograph or images. Image masking is used very often to hide the background of an image. Later we can change the background, or let the background remain transparent.

In most browsers the background image will be shown. If the image has been configured so as not to repeat, and the element is larger than the background image then the area that is not covered by the background image will display the background color. DJL
Go to your tumblr customize html. Press Ctrl F and type 'background' (without quotation marks) if you find something under the .body like this: background: #FFFFFF; (or another color code) change it to: background-image: url(YOURIMGHERE); If that code is already there, then just put the URL of the image in the brackets
